diff options
| author | 2017-11-15 19:08:30 +0000 | |
|---|---|---|
| committer | 2017-11-15 19:08:30 +0000 | |
| commit | 858c934b5d489152a5b9011acca3fdec41e6da2a (patch) | |
| tree | 7bf737b663755e3a1cb9152c6f4c45e9b9e8d1aa | |
| parent | 4a59e56a347a311f301afaf24bff5f6b771ee255 (diff) | |
| parent | e842e266a6b862bbe757c92ce6d6a42260077bd9 (diff) | |
Merge "Avoid overflow in focus fudge calculation" am: 795d4a5aa4
am: e842e266a6
Change-Id: I0509b4debdf634075df7d8f63516d0b8e18e4b8c
| -rw-r--r-- | core/java/android/view/FocusFinder.java | 2 |
1 files changed, 1 insertions, 1 deletions
diff --git a/core/java/android/view/FocusFinder.java b/core/java/android/view/FocusFinder.java index 74555de5f291..713cfb48c95f 100644 --- a/core/java/android/view/FocusFinder.java +++ b/core/java/android/view/FocusFinder.java @@ -530,7 +530,7 @@ public class FocusFinder { * axis distances. Warning: this fudge factor is finely tuned, be sure to * run all focus tests if you dare tweak it. */ - int getWeightedDistanceFor(int majorAxisDistance, int minorAxisDistance) { + long getWeightedDistanceFor(long majorAxisDistance, long minorAxisDistance) { return 13 * majorAxisDistance * majorAxisDistance + minorAxisDistance * minorAxisDistance; } |